Louise Denton-Snape . 2024-01-29

MORE AT Google

I was pleasantly surprised to come across this little gem! I wanted to take my wife out for a nice dinner but wanted to find something a little different and stumbled on "Chez Dominique" by Googling the best places to eat in Bath. The restaurant décor is cosy, the staff were all friendly and helpful and the food was nicely presented and very tasty. On top of all that, it was reasonably priced too. My wife and I both had 3 courses from the lunch menu and can highly recommend the "Duck rillettes, Asian salad, sesame & soy dressing" and "Sauté scallops, chorizo, saffron aioli, chickpea stew" from the starters. We both enjoyed the "Onglet steak, Café de Paris butter, pommes frites" for our main course, as this came highly recommended by diners on Google reviews. We finished off with a "Toasted oat panna cotta, pear purée, candied peel biscuit" and a "Chocolate & stout cake, stem ginger Chantilly cream, candied walnuts" for dessert all of which were delicious! We will definitely be returning!

Andrei Calabangiu . 2023-12-28

MORE AT Google

The location (30 yards from Pulteney Bridge), staff service and atmosphere are all reasons to visit whilst in Bath. The food was of a good standard: garlic olives as an appetiser, starters of sauteed scallops with chorizo and chickpea stew and a smoked mackerel pate; main courses consisting of steamed trout with crispy noodles, and roasted chicken with chorizo alongside an additional extra of green beans cooked with almonds. Our bill came to a little over £107 which included one small beer, a 250ml glass of red wine plus a table water. A 12.5% discretionary service charge is included within the bill. The staff are attentive without being intrusive, and the food was served quickly although it was not piping hot when reaching the table. I thought the bill was a little on the high side, but it was certainly a pleasurable enough dining experience.
